Alcohol In Breast Milk: What Pumping Moms Need To Know

does alcohol leave pumped breast milk

Many new mothers who breastfeed may wonder whether alcohol consumed can transfer into pumped breast milk and if so, how long it remains detectable. This concern arises from the desire to ensure the safety and well-being of their infants, as alcohol can potentially affect a baby’s development and sleep patterns. Research indicates that alcohol does indeed pass into breast milk, with levels peaking around 30 to 60 minutes after consumption and gradually decreasing as the body metabolizes it. The general guideline suggests that alcohol clears from breast milk at the same rate it clears from the bloodstream, typically at a rate of about 0.015% per hour. However, the exact time it takes for alcohol to leave pumped breast milk can vary depending on factors such as the amount consumed, the mother’s metabolism, and body weight. To minimize risk, many experts recommend waiting at least 2 to 3 hours per standard drink before breastfeeding or pumping, though some mothers choose to pump and discard milk during this period to maintain milk supply. Understanding these dynamics can help breastfeeding mothers make informed decisions about alcohol consumption while prioritizing their baby’s health.

Alcohol metabolism in breast milk

Understanding this process is crucial for timing breastfeeding sessions. For instance, if a mother consumes one standard drink, she should wait at least 2 hours before nursing to ensure minimal alcohol transfer to the infant. Pumping and discarding milk during this period does not expedite the elimination of alcohol from the body; it merely removes the milk containing alcohol. Tools like breast milk alcohol test strips can provide a practical way to monitor alcohol levels in milk, though their accuracy varies. The key takeaway is that alcohol leaves breast milk as it metabolizes in the mother’s body, not through external actions like pumping or time-based separation.

Comparatively, the impact of alcohol on infants is more significant than on adults due to their immature metabolic systems. Infants metabolize alcohol at half the rate of adults, making them more susceptible to its effects, including drowsiness, weak suckling, and disrupted sleep patterns. Studies suggest that moderate alcohol consumption (up to 1 standard drink per day) may not harm the infant, but heavier or frequent intake can lead to reduced motor development and cognitive delays. This highlights the importance of moderation and planning for breastfeeding mothers who choose to consume alcohol.

Safe waiting time after drinking

Alcohol consumption and breastfeeding is a delicate balance, with the timing of alcohol elimination from breast milk being a critical factor. The body metabolizes alcohol at a relatively constant rate, approximately 0.015% BAC (blood alcohol content) per hour, regardless of body weight or alcohol tolerance. This means that the time it takes for alcohol to leave the system, and consequently breast milk, depends on the amount consumed. For instance, a standard drink, defined as 14 grams of pure alcohol (equivalent to a 12-ounce beer, 5-ounce glass of wine, or 1.5-ounce shot of distilled spirits), typically takes about 2-3 hours to metabolize.

From a practical standpoint, determining a safe waiting time after drinking requires a tailored approach. As a general guideline, waiting at least 2 hours per standard drink before nursing or pumping is recommended. For example, if a breastfeeding mother consumes 2 standard drinks, she should wait approximately 4-6 hours before feeding her baby. However, this is a conservative estimate, and individual factors such as body weight, metabolism, and overall health can influence alcohol elimination. Effects on baby’s health

Alcohol passes directly into breast milk, reaching concentrations similar to those in maternal blood. This means that when a breastfeeding mother consumes alcohol, her baby ingests a proportionate amount through nursing. The American Academy of Pediatrics advises that no amount of alcohol is considered completely safe for infants, as their developing bodies metabolize alcohol much slower than adults. Even small quantities can lead to detectable levels in the baby’s system, potentially affecting their health. For context, if a mother consumes one standard drink (12 ounces of beer, 5 ounces of wine, or 1.5 ounces of liquor), it takes approximately 2–3 hours for her body to eliminate the alcohol, during which time it remains in her milk.

The effects of alcohol in breast milk on a baby’s health can vary depending on the infant’s age, weight, and the amount of alcohol consumed. Newborns and younger infants are particularly vulnerable due to their immature liver function, which limits their ability to process alcohol efficiently. Exposure to alcohol through breast milk has been linked to decreased milk intake, poor sleep quality, and altered motor development in babies. For example, studies show that infants exposed to alcohol in breast milk may exhibit deeper sleep initially, but this is followed by more frequent awakenings and fussiness. While these effects are generally mild and temporary, repeated exposure could potentially impact long-term development.

Pumping and discarding breast milk after drinking alcohol (often referred to as "pumping and dumping") is a common practice, but it does not accelerate the elimination of alcohol from the milk. The only way to reduce alcohol levels is to wait for the body to metabolize it naturally. Testing alcohol levels in milk

Alcohol consumption by breastfeeding mothers often raises concerns about its presence in breast milk. Testing alcohol levels in milk provides a scientific approach to addressing these concerns, ensuring safety for both mother and infant. Various methods exist, ranging from simple at-home tests to laboratory-grade analyses, each with its own accuracy and practicality. For instance, portable breathalyzer-style devices designed for milk testing offer quick results but may lack precision compared to gas chromatography, a gold standard method used in research settings. Understanding these tools helps mothers make informed decisions about breastfeeding after alcohol consumption.

To test alcohol levels in breast milk at home, mothers can use test strips specifically designed for this purpose. These strips detect ethanol and provide a visual indicator, often changing color to signify alcohol presence. While convenient, they typically measure in broad ranges (e.g., 0.02% to 0.1% alcohol by volume) and may not account for individual metabolic differences. For more accurate results, electric milk analyzers, though pricier, offer digital readouts and can detect lower alcohol concentrations. Always follow the manufacturer’s instructions, ensuring the milk sample is at room temperature and properly mixed before testing.

Laboratory testing provides the most precise measurement of alcohol in breast milk, often using techniques like gas chromatography or mass spectrometry. These methods can detect alcohol levels as low as 0.001%, far surpassing at-home options. However, they are time-consuming and costly, typically reserved for research or clinical studies. Mothers seeking this level of detail might consult healthcare providers to arrange testing, though it’s rarely necessary for casual alcohol consumption. Understanding that alcohol metabolizes at a rate of approximately 0.015% BAC per hour helps contextualize lab results and their relevance to breastfeeding safety.

A critical consideration when testing alcohol levels is timing. Alcohol appears in breast milk within 30–60 minutes of consumption and clears at the same rate it metabolizes in the bloodstream. Testing immediately after drinking may yield high levels, but retesting every 2–3 hours shows a steady decline. For example, a mother who consumes one standard drink (12 oz beer, 5 oz wine, or 1.5 oz liquor) can expect alcohol to be undetectable in milk within 2–3 hours. Frequently asked questions

Alcohol leaves breast milk as it metabolizes in the mother’s body, typically at the same rate as it leaves the bloodstream. There is no specific "waiting time" to ensure all alcohol is gone, as it depends on factors like the amount consumed and individual metabolism.

Pumping and dumping is not necessary unless you’re uncomfortable or engorged. Alcohol in breast milk is in the same concentration as in the mother’s bloodstream, and it naturally metabolizes over time.

Waiting 2-3 hours per standard drink (12 oz beer, 5 oz wine, 1.5 oz liquor) is a general guideline, but it’s best to test your milk with a breast milk alcohol test strip or consult a healthcare provider for personalized advice.

Small amounts of alcohol in breast milk are unlikely to harm a baby, but excessive consumption can affect milk production and infant behavior. It’s best to limit alcohol intake and avoid breastfeeding if heavily intoxicated.

Freezing does not remove alcohol from breast milk. Alcohol will remain in the milk until it metabolizes in the mother’s body, regardless of storage methods.
